    Yeast Cinnamon Rolls and Biscuit Dough


    Source of Recipe


    Family recipe

    List of Ingredients




    --- Yeast Biscuit Dough ---
    2 Pkgs. Yeast
    1 Cup Warm Water
    2 Tablespoons Sugar
    2 Cups Buttermilk
    3/4 Cup Wesson Oil (grandma Used Melted Lard)
    � cup Sugar
    4 Teaspoons Baking Powder
    1/4 Teaspoon Baking Soda
    1 � Teaspoons Salt
    6 Cups Flour

    --- Cinnamon Rolls ---
    2 Cups Flour
    1 Stick Butter, melted
    1 Cup Chopped Pecans
    Cinnamon to Taste
    Sugar to Taste

    Recipe



    --- Yeast Biscuit Dough ---
    Mix yeast, 2 tablespoons sugar and warm water in a small bowl; set aside for at least 10 minutes in a warm place.

    Combine buttermilk, sugar and oil. Mix yeast mixture with milk mixture.

    Sift together dry ingredients, then mix with liquid mixture, blending well. Let stand 10 minutes or longer. At this point, you can refrigerate the mixture to use later.

    Roll out like homemade biscuits (in 2 cups flour spread out on waxed paper, or a floured board). Roll individual biscuits with hands. Let rise in a warm place until doubled in size (several hours).

    Put into heated baking dishes or muffin pans (preferred) which have been sprayed with Pam. Bake at approximately 400 degrees for 15-20 minutes, depending on your oven.

    NOTE: This keeps in refrigerator for 2 weeks.


    --- Cinnamon Rolls ---
    After mixing the homemade yeast biscuit dough, spread waxed paper on countertop and dust with 2 cups flour. Pour out dough mixture and knead lightly to stiffen the dough. Make sure flour is spread beyond the dough. Roll out dough with rolling pin to �" thickness.

    Spread melted butter over entire surface of rolled out dough. Sift cinnamon and sugar over the entire surface, and then sprinkle the chopped pecans over all.

    Roll up dough to make a log shaped roll. Cut into 1" thick slices (being careful not to flatten each roll). Place slices in greased baking dish and sprinkle with more sugar, cinnamon and pecan pieces; then spray Pam over all. Bake at 350 degrees for 20-25 minutes.
